Wood window service encompasses a range of maintenance, repair, and restoration tasks aimed at preserving the functionality and appearance of wooden windows. These services often include addressing issues such as rotting wood, damaged frames, broken or stuck sashes, and deteriorating paint or finish. Professionals may also perform tasks like re-glazing, sealing, and weatherproofing to enhance the window's performance and longevity. Properly maintained wood windows can improve a property's aesthetic appeal while ensuring they operate smoothly and efficiently.
One of the primary problems addressed by wood window services is wood decay caused by moisture infiltration. Over time, exposure to rain, humidity, and temperature fluctuations can lead to rotting, warping, or cracking of the wood components. Additionally, issues like drafts, difficulty opening or closing, and peeling paint are common concerns that can diminish energy efficiency and curb appeal. Skilled service providers help resolve these problems through repairs or replacements, restoring the window's structural integrity and visual charm.

Replacement Costs - Replacing wood windows typically ranges from $300 to $1,000 per window, depending on size and style. For example, a standard double-hung window might cost around $500 to replace. Costs vary based on the window's complexity and materials used.
Repair Expenses - Repairing wood window components generally falls between $150 and $600 per window. Common repairs include restoring rotted wood or replacing broken parts, with costs influenced by the extent of damage. Larger or more intricate repairs tend to be more expensive.
Refinishing Prices - Refinishing or restoring wood windows usually costs between $200 and $600 per window. This includes sanding, staining, and sealing to improve appearance and durability. The scope of refinishing affects the final price, with more extensive work costing more.
Material and Labor Estimates - The combined cost for materials and labor for wood window services can vary widely, often ranging from $250 to $1,200 per window. Factors include window size, type, and local labor rates, which influence the overall expense.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of wood windows do service providers commonly work with? Local pros typically service a variety of wood window styles, including double-hung, casement, and picture windows, providing repairs and replacements as needed.
Can wood window services help improve energy efficiency? Yes, many service providers offer upgrades such as weatherstripping, sealing, or window replacement to enhance energy performance.
What signs indicate that a wood window needs repair or replacement? Signs include rotting wood, cracked or broken glass, difficulty opening or closing, and drafts around the window frame.
Are there options for restoring historic or antique wood windows? Yes, specialists often provide restoration services to preserve the character of historic wood windows while ensuring functionality.
How do service providers handle wood window maintenance and repairs? They typically assess the condition of the wood, remove damaged sections, treat for pests or rot, and apply protective finishes or replacements as necessary.
